The course was a 01 full day affair which ran all the way till 6.30pm but it was both engaging & interactive with participation from all attendees including yours truly whom had to do ‘presentation’ a couple of times as the ladies in my group were just too shy..yeah we were seated according to a total of 06 (round tables) groups of single ladies, the married before ladies, single men & the married before men. As a whole, we were quite a loud and big group of people whom all seek the purpose of sharing and learning towards a blissful 2nd (3rd, 4th etc) marriage. There were quite a number of single ladies & men whose partner was married before & of course, they have quite a different perspective towards some aspects of the married life, kids, financial etc. It was interesting and at the same time enriching to hear the many different stories & past cases from Syariah plus the views from Ustaz (2nd half of the day involved sharing & views from the religious aspect).mujahidin_mosque

Topics from step parenting, step families integration, financial, moral & emotional needs, religion, case studies, role-play were discussed & included. I would highly recommend this course for all  Muslim remarrying couples or even if 1 half of the couple has been married before..trust me, it is beneficial and certainly not your typical, monotonous  kursus rumah tangga held at a Masjid.
